A container for an immutable value that allows sneaky reloading in debug mode (via UnsafeCell) while keeping the data safe and constant in release mode. This allows you to tweak data while testing an application, without having that data be mutable when the application is released. Intended for use with game assets, but suitable for any interactive application.

Ruby 1.9's require_relative for Rubinius and MRI 1.8. We also add abs_path which is like __FILE__ but __FILE__ can be fooled by a sneaky "chdir" while abs_path can't. If you are running on Ruby 1.9 or greater, require_relative is the pre-defined version. The benefit we provide in this situation by this package is the ability to write the same require_relative sequence in Rubinius 1.8 and Ruby 1.9.
